Output 64577d8e5c4932e9414ffe4be5e3356b0aac6865418174176c9c44c6c06e5388:1

value
1377192
script pubkey
OP_0 OP_PUSHBYTES_20 a1e0ab952d8f86a01cdf9bbd4ab327b4b89520db
address
bc1q58s2h9fd37r2q8xlnw754ve8kjuf2gxma768c6
transaction
64577d8e5c4932e9414ffe4be5e3356b0aac6865418174176c9c44c6c06e5388